Sana’a – The College of Engineering at the University of Science and Technology (UST) held a scientific workshop today to develop the College’s academic program plans. The workshop, which brought together heads of academic departments and program coordinators, was chaired by the Dean of the College, Prof. Adnan Al‑Mutawakkil. It focused on discussing the development of academic program plans in line with the unified plan approved by the Ministry of Education and Scientific Research.

During the workshop, participants discussed a number of key themes related to academic program development, including reviewing current study plans, updating courses to keep pace with scientific and technological advancements, and emphasizing the improvement of learning outcomes and their alignment with labor market needs.
The discussions also addressed mechanisms for unifying shared courses among academic departments, contributing to academic integration, reducing duplication in scientific content, and enhancing the efficiency of the educational process within the College.
The workshop concluded with several important recommendations and outcomes, foremost among them ensuring that program plans are fully aligned with the ministerial framework, working to integrate common courses across departments, and establishing follow-up mechanisms to ensure the implementation of the proposed updates according to a defined timeline.
